Follow the following steps:
- Create a new page (Pages => Add New )
- Add a View block (As soon as YOu add it, it will show you two options, Create a New view Or Use Existing)
- Under Create a New View section, give your view new view name
- follow the wizard, See this video: hidden link

First of all, you can not use two page builders like Blocks and Elementor, simply you should not mix both. You never mentioned that you are using Elementor.

Please check the following Doc to know how you can use Elementor with Toolset:
=> https://toolset.com/documentation/user-guides/using-toolset-with-elementor-page-builder/

You need to either go with Blocks or Elementor. If you will use Elementor, you need to use the classic views.
